I have  a windows xp ., and recently switched internet service to att/yahoo and
when trying to download the antivirus protection online(from same internet provider )  I get to the install page.  it jumps to a window where it says: unable to navigate the webpage.  I am conected to the internet, I have checked all connections., and last two TIMES I tried to correct the problem with tech.support , I guess they do not have an idea since they have not been able to help me so FAR. I know I can buy it , but since is free with the PACKAGE .  I did have norton before but I made sure I uninstalled it before trying to install the yahoo SOFTWARE. A better solution:

Anti-Virus
AVG Free
Avast

Choose only one.
Then add the following:

Spybot Search and Destroy

AdAware

AVG Anti-Spyware

CCleaner.

You will now have a WELL rounded protection package that will perform better than most ISP packages without being a hog on System Resources...

Best of all it's all FREE.

But you have to update and run scans regularly for it to be effective.
